/**
* Configure your Gatsby site with this file.
*
* See: https://www.gatsbyjs.com/docs/gatsby-config/
*/
const path = require(`path`)
const assert = require('assert')
require('dotenv').config({
path: '.env'
})
// Set the environment depending on the branch name from Netlify.
// Can use different env variables depending on this variable.
let env = 'DEVELOP'
if (process.env.BRANCH === 'master') {
env = 'MASTER'
} else if (process.env.BRANCH === 'test') {
env = 'TEST'
}
// Throttle file downloads from Drupal unless on master.
// Due to Pantheon/Acquia worker resources only available on live.
let concurrentFileRequests = process.env.BRANCH === 'master' ? 20 : 2
// These values are required for a fully functioning site. List all required env vars here.
const requiredEnvValues = [`DRUPAL`, `DRUPAL_API_KEY`]
// Fail fast if a required value is missing from .env
requiredEnvValues.forEach((name) => {
assert(process.env[name], `${name} must be defined in .env.`)
})
// Set site url.
// Default to URL set in env.
let siteUrl = process.env.URL
if (env === 'DEVELOP') {
siteUrl = 'https://dev.mysite.com'
}
if (env === 'TEST') {
siteUrl = 'https://test.mysite.com'
}
module.exports = {
siteMetadata: {
title: 'Mediacurrent Gatsby Starter',
siteUrl: siteUrl
},
// Proxy local runtime queries to avoid CORS errors for when you may query Drupal client side.
proxy: {
prefix: '/jsonapi',
url: process.env.DRUPAL
},
plugins: [
'gatsby-plugin-react-helmet',
'gatsby-transformer-sharp',
'gatsby-transformer-files',
'@mediacurrent/gatsby-plugin-silence-css-order-warning',
'gatsby-plugin-loadable-storybook',
'gatsby-plugin-sharp',
'gatsby-plugin-sass',
'gatsby-plugin-image',
// Allows lazy loading components.
`gatsby-plugin-loadable-components-ssr`,
// Sourcing images for use with gatsby-image.
{
resolve: `gatsby-source-filesystem`,
options: {
name: `images`,
path: path.join(__dirname, `src`, `images`)
}
},
{
// Set robots.txt by environment.
resolve: 'gatsby-plugin-robots-txt',
options: {
resolveEnv: () => env,
env: {
MASTER: {
policy: [
{
userAgent: '*',
// Add pages to disallow for prod here.
disallow: ['/login']
}
]
},
TEST: {
policy: [{ userAgent: '*', disallow: ['/'] }],
sitemap: null,
host: null
},
DEVELOP: {
policy: [{ userAgent: '*', disallow: ['/'] }],
sitemap: null,
host: null
}
}
}
},
// {
// resolve: 'gatsby-source-drupal',
// options: {
// baseUrl: process.env[`DRUPAL`],
// preview: true,
// concurrentFileRequests: concurrentFileRequests,
// // For all non-local environments, Gatsby accesses Drupal using a user
// // named `gatsby` with the API Services role. The API Key for this user
// // can be found in Drupal by finding the gatsby user and checking the
// // key authentication tab.
// //
// // The reason for this is that there are some fields that are not used
// // by any published content, and so excluding unpublished content during
// // build breaks the graphql schema. An alternative solution would be to
// // create custom GraphQL schema for empty fields as noted here:
// // eslint-disable-next-line max-len
// // https://www.jamesdflynn.com/development/gatsbyjs-drupal-create-custom-graphql-schema-empty-fields
// disallowedLinkTypes: ['self', 'describedby'],
// // If auth is needed, use this pattern, otherwise delete.
// headers: {
// 'api-key': process.env[`DRUPAL_API_KEY`]
// },
// basicAuth: {
// username: process.env[`DRUPAL_BASIC_AUTH_USERNAME`],
// password: process.env[`DRUPAL_BASIC_AUTH_PASSWORD`]
// }
// }
// },
// Allows importing SVGs as React components.
{
resolve: 'gatsby-plugin-react-svg',
options: {
rule: {
include: /assets\/.+\.svg$/
}
}
},
{
resolve: 'gatsby-plugin-env-variables',
options: {
// Add process.env variables here that you want available in React code.
whitelist: []
}
},
{
resolve: 'gatsby-plugin-advanced-sitemap',
options: {
query: `
{
site {
siteMetadata {
siteUrl
}
}
}`,
// Pages to exclude from sitemap.
exclude: [],
createLinkInHead: true,
addUncaughtPages: true
}
},
